Degree of Structure
Describe what do you mean by Degree of Structure?
Expert
1. Unstructured or nondirective: in which you ask questions as they come to mind. To follow there is no fixed format.
2. Structured or directive: in which the questions and acceptable responses are specified in advance. The reactions are evaluated for suitability of content.
Structured and non-structured interviews have their pros and cons. In structured interviews all candidates are usually requested all essential questions by all interviewers. Structured interviews are usually more effective. However structured interviews do not allow the flexibility to pursue points of interests as they develop.
